I was just listening to this song and something sprung out at me. I keep thinking about that scene in the movie Inception where Mal jumps, the insistence that this isn't really real.

I think the key to this song may the lines:

"You say: 'It's simple: we die just to live again' You say: 'We're waiting for the last waltz' "

If we look at those lines and place them in the broader context of the song, it could suggest something like the person this song is sung to (the "you") believes that we keep on living lives over and over again, waiting for the final life (last waltz) that will finally be... good enough? The end of the revolutions?

Or, alternatively, the "you" in the song believes that love is like a phoenixes life cycle, "we die just to live again", that relationships, too, must die and then be revived to die again and so on, so she "kills" the relationship ("highlight of the night is the unhappy ending...") until it can be... perfect? something... which would be the "last waltz", the last time they'd have to go through the relationship.

i have a thing for the melody of this sing...it has this depressing tone. ANYWAY...

i think this song talks about a relationship reaching its end on the girl's side. this relationship is metaphorically portrayed as a waltz. At a dance, the last waltz is the VERY VERY LAST dance at the END of the dance, the closing for the evening. i suppose that in her point of view, she realizes that this relationship that was once beautiful (all the other romance that they had before this last waltz) is coming to a close on her part. she doesn't like him anymore and he's starting to feel it. his feeling haven't faded yet, and he 's getting insecure about her affections for him. She's trying to make the end something nice, like the last waltz, but it is all in all, still The End of their relationship.
